SVS Sound, a renowned manufacturer of high-performance audio equipment, is headquartered in Youngstown, Ohio, USA. The company specializes in producing premium subwoofers, speakers, and audio accessories designed to deliver immersive sound experiences for home theater and music enthusiasts. While their main operations are based in Ohio, SVS has a global presence, with distribution networks and authorized dealers spanning across North America, Europe, Asia, and beyond.
